What is one abiotic factor that could influence a squirrel living in a forest

Respuesta :

uhohspaghettiooo
uhohspaghettiooo uhohspaghettiooo
  • 13-10-2021

Answer:

Fire

Explanation:

Fire is abiotic (nonliving), and it can influence a squirrel living in a forest because the fire can burn down the squirrel's habitat
